Recognize When Your Pool Heater Needs Repair
Contact Pool Heater Repair Pros in Parishville, NY if you notice any of the following issues:
- Slow Heating: If your pool heater takes a long time to warm up, it may need a thermostat or filter check.
- Gas Odor: A gas smell near the heater could indicate a leak that needs immediate attention.
- Visible Rust: Rust or corrosion on heater parts suggests it needs maintenance.
- Frequent On-Off Cycling: Constant cycling on and off may signal an electrical or thermostat issue.
- Higher Energy Bills: Rising energy costs often mean the heater is operating inefficiently and needs service.
